Learn more about Urakawa

Nestled along Hokkaido's southeastern coast, Urakawa invites visitors to watch thoroughbred horses training at JRA Hidaka Ikusei Ranch before hiking the scenic trails of Mount Kamui. Take in sweeping Pacific Ocean views from Shiomigaoka Park, then visit the bustling Urakawa Port where local fishermen bring in their fresh daily catch.
